過濾選擇器主要是通過特定的過濾規則來篩選出所需的dom元素,過濾規則與css中的偽類選擇器語法相同,即選擇器都以乙個冒號(:)開頭。按照不同的過濾規則,過濾選擇器可以分為基本過濾、內容過濾、可見性過濾、屬性過濾、子元素過濾和表單物件屬性過濾選擇器。
基本過濾選擇器
選擇器
描述
返回
示例
:first
選取第乙個元素
單個元素
$(「div:first」)選取所有div元素中的第乙個div元素
:last
選取最後乙個元素
集合元素
$(「input:not:(.myclass)」)選取class不是myclass的input元素
:even
選取索引是偶數的所有元素,注意:索引是從0開始的
集合元素
$(「input:even」)選取索引是偶數的input元素。
:odd
選取索引是奇數的所有元素,注意:索引是從0開始的
集合元素
$(「input:odd」)選取索引是奇數的input元素。
:eq(index)
選取索引等於index的元素,注意:索引是從0開始的
集合元素
$(「input:eq(1)」)選取索引等於1的input元素。實際上選擇的是第二個input元素
:gt(index)
選取索引大於index的元素,注意:索引是從0開始的
集合元素
$(「input:gt(1)」)選取索引大於1的input元素。
:lt(index)
選取索引小於index的元素,注意:索引是從0開始的
集合元素
$(「input:lt(1)」)選取索引小於於1的input元素。這個就等同於$(「input:eq(0)」)
:header
選取所有的標題元素,例如h1,h2,h3…..
集合元素
$(「:header」)選取網頁中所有的h1,h2,h3….
:animated
選取當前正在執行動畫的所有元素
集合元素
$(「div:animated」)選取正在執行動畫的div元素
jQuery過濾選擇器 基本過濾選擇器
過濾選擇器主要是通過特定的過濾規則來篩選出所需的dom元素,過濾規則與css中的偽類選擇器語法相同,即選擇器都以乙個冒號 開頭。按照不同的過濾規則,過濾選擇器可以分為基本過濾 內容過濾 可見性過濾 屬性過濾 子元素過濾和表單物件屬性過濾選擇器。基本過濾選擇器 選擇器 描述 返回 示例 first 選...
Jquery過濾選擇器之基本過濾選擇器
過濾選擇器主要是通過特定的過濾規則來篩選出所需要的dom元素,過濾規則與css中的偽類選擇器語法相同,即選擇器都可以以乙個冒號 開頭。按照不同的過濾規則,過濾選擇器可以分為基本過濾 內容過濾 可見性過濾 屬性過濾 子元素過濾和表單物件屬性過濾選擇器。首先介紹基本過濾選擇器 選擇器描述 返回例項 fi...
jQuery過濾選擇器
基本過濾選擇器 first 選取第乙個元素 last 選取最後乙個元素 not selector 去除所有與給定選擇器匹配的元素 even 選取索引是偶數的所有元素,索引從0開始 odd 選取索引是奇數的所有元素,索引從0開始 eq index 選取索引等於index的元素 index從0開始 gt...